Study of geometrically similar rockets of different sizes; essential difference between large and small missiles from standpoint of designer; it appears that rocket of 50 tons launching weight might have minimum proportion of deadweight; factors which will set limit to ultimate size of missiles. From paper before High Altitude and Satellite Rocket Symposium.
